Key Considerations Before You Buy
Before you fall in love with a specific design
it's crucial to address the practicalities of fitting a 60 inch dresser into your home. The most important step is to measure your space with precision. While the 60-inch width is the defining feature
don't neglect the other two dimensions: depth and height. A standard dresser is typically 18 to 22 inches deep. Measure the intended spot and use painter's tape to mark the dresser's footprint on the floor. This simple visualization helps you understand its true scale and ensures you have enough clearance to walk around it comfortably. Remember to account for fully extended drawers
which will require an additional 15 to 20 inches of open space in front. Equally important is the delivery path. Measure the width and height of all doorways
hallways
and stairwells the dresser must pass through. Many older homes have narrower openings
and there's nothing more frustrating than discovering your beautiful new furniture can't make it into the room. Check the product specifications for its assembled dimensions
and if it arrives pre-assembled
confirm that it will clear every corner on its journey to its final destination.
The material of your 60 inch dresser will heavily influence its durability
style
and price point
making it one of the most significant decisions in the selection process. Understanding the differences between the common options will help you choose a piece that aligns with your lifestyle and budget.
Solid Wood
Dressers crafted from solid woods like oak
walnut
maple
or pine are renowned for their strength and longevity. These are heirloom-quality pieces that can last for generations with proper care. Solid wood showcases natural grain patterns
making each piece unique. It can also be sanded and refinished over the years to repair scratches or update its look. The primary downsides are its higher cost and significant weight
which can make it difficult to move.
Engineered Wood
Engineered wood
including Medium-Density Fiberboard (MDF) and particleboard
is a more budget-friendly alternative. These materials are made from wood fibers or particles compressed with adhesive. They are often covered with a wood veneer or a laminate finish
allowing for a vast array of colors and styles. While less expensive
engineered wood is generally not as durable as solid wood. It's more susceptible to scratches
and water damage can cause it to swell or warp irreparably. However
for a trendy piece or a home with a tighter budget
a high-quality engineered wood dresser can be an excellent choice.
Mixed Materials
A growing trend in furniture design is the use of mixed materials. You might find a 60 inch dresser with a solid wood frame
metal legs
and rattan or cane drawer fronts. These designs often blend different aesthetics
such as industrial and bohemian
creating a unique focal point. Metal hardware
drawer glides
and internal supports are also key components to inspect
as high-quality hardware ensures smooth function and contributes to the overall sturdiness of the piece
regardless of the primary material.
Styling Your 60-Inch Dresser for Maximum Impact
Once you’ve chosen the perfect 60 inch dresser
the next step is to integrate it seamlessly into your existing decor. The goal is to make it feel like an intentional and harmonious part of the room rather than a standalone object. Start by considering the overall style of your space. If your room has a Mid-Century Modern aesthetic
look for a dresser with clean lines
tapered legs
and warm wood tones like walnut or teak. For a Farmhouse or rustic vibe
a distressed white or natural pine dresser with classic hardware will fit right in. Industrial spaces call for dressers that mix wood and dark metal elements
while a minimalist room would benefit from a sleek
handle-less design in a neutral color like white
black
or gray. The key is to echo the existing colors
textures
and shapes in the room. If your walls are a cool blue
a dresser with cool-toned wood or gray finish will create a cohesive look. Conversely
a warm wood dresser can add a beautiful
grounding contrast to a cool-toned room. Don't be afraid to mix styles
but ensure there's a common thread—be it color
material
or form—that ties the dresser to the rest of your furniture.
The large surface of a 60 inch dresser is prime real estate for creating a stylish and personal display. The key to successful styling is creating balance
visual interest
and a sense of order. A popular interior design principle to follow is the "Rule of Threes," which suggests that items grouped in threes are more appealing and memorable. However
you can adapt this to a more general formula for a balanced look.
- Create an Anchor: Start with a large focal point to ground the arrangement. A round or rectangular mirror hung directly above the dresser is a classic choice that also makes the room feel larger and brighter. Alternatively
a large piece of framed art or a gallery wall of smaller prints can serve as a stunning backdrop.
- Vary Heights: To create visual rhythm
place items of different heights on the surface. A tall table lamp on one side provides both ambient lighting and verticality. Balance it on the other side with a grouping of objects
such as a medium-height vase with fresh or faux botanicals and a shorter stack of decorative books.
- Add Layers and Texture: Incorporate different textures to add depth. A decorative tray is perfect for corralling smaller items like perfume bottles
jewelry
or a candle
creating a neat and organized cluster. A small ceramic bowl
a textured vase
or a metallic object can add another layer of interest.
- Incorporate Personal Touches: Your dresser should reflect your personality. Add a framed photo
a meaningful souvenir
or a small plant. These items make the arrangement feel unique and lived-in.
- Embrace Negative Space: The most common styling mistake is overcrowding. Don't feel obligated to fill every inch of the surface. Leaving some empty space allows each item to breathe and gives the arrangement a more curated
high-end feel.

Maximizing Storage with Your 60-Inch Dresser
The key to successfully utilizing your 60-inch dresser lies in effective organization. This isn't just about neatly folding clothes; it's about maximizing the vertical space and considering drawer dividers or organizers. For example
the taller drawers are ideal for bulky items like sweaters or folded linens. Using drawer dividers allows you to separate different categories of clothing – shirts in one section
pants in another – significantly increasing the capacity of your drawers and making locating items much simpler. Consider using shallow drawers for folded t-shirts or underwear and deeper drawers for sweaters or jeans. Investing in drawer organizers
like foldable fabric cubes or drawer inserts
can significantly improve storage efficiency. These organizers prevent clothes from becoming jumbled and crushed
helping them retain their shape and improving the longevity of your garments. Furthermore
consider the placement of items within drawers: often placing heavier items at the bottom and lighter items on top. This simple technique prevents drawers from becoming unbalanced and prevents the drawer from becoming overly difficult to open or close. Regular purging of old or unwanted clothing can also help maintain efficient use of your 60-inch dresser's ample space. This thoughtful approach to organization ensures your 60-inch dresser is not only a stylish addition to your room but a true storage workhorse for years to come.
